Divorce laws in Malaysia are governed by different statutes depending on whether you are a Muslim or a non-Muslim. Non-Muslims are subject to the Law Reform (Marriage and Divorce) Act 1976, while Muslims follow Syariah laws. Given the legal distinctions and procedures involved, hiring a divorce lawyer is crucial for several reasons:


  • Legal Guidance: A lawyer helps you understand your rights, obligations, and the legal options available.

  • Paperwork and Procedures: Divorce involves a significant amount of documentation, and a lawyer ensures that everything is filed correctly and on time.

  • Negotiation and Mediation: If there are disputes over assets, child custody, or maintenance, a lawyer can negotiate favorable terms for you.

  • Court Representation: If the divorce is contested, a lawyer will represent you in court to advocate for your best interests.


Selecting the right divorce lawyer in Malaysia can impact the outcome of your case. Here are some key considerations:

  1. Experience and Specialization


Look for a lawyer who specializes in family law and has experience handling divorce cases similar to yours. A lawyer familiar with the intricacies of divorce law will provide better legal representation.

  1. Reputation and Client Reviews


Check online reviews, testimonials, and recommendations from previous clients. A lawyer with a strong reputation is likely to provide professional and reliable services.

  1. Legal Fees and Transparency


Understand the fee structure before hiring a lawyer. Some lawyers charge a fixed fee, while others charge hourly rates. Ensure that the lawyer provides a transparent breakdown of costs to avoid unexpected expenses.

  1. Communication and Availability


Your lawyer should be approachable and responsive to your queries. Effective communication ensures that you stay informed about the progress of your case.

  1. Compatibility and Trust


Since divorce is a personal matter, you should feel comfortable discussing your concerns with your lawyer. Trust and confidentiality are essential in legal representation.

The divorce process in Malaysia varies based on whether the divorce is mutual (uncontested) or disputed (contested). Here’s how a lawyer assists in each scenario:

Uncontested Divorce

  • Both parties agree to the divorce terms.

  • The lawyer drafts and files the divorce petition.

  • Court approval is obtained, and the divorce is finalized relatively quickly.


Contested Divorce

  • One party does not agree to the divorce or its terms.

  • The lawyer represents their client in court, presenting evidence and arguments.

  • The court decides on issues such as child custody, alimony, and asset division.

  • The lawyer ensures the best possible outcome for their client.
